Top Meal Prep Apps for Parents
1. Plan To Eat
Plan To Eat is a favorite among parents for its ability to streamline recipe organization and meal planning. Its user-friendly interface allows you to save and categorize your favorite recipes, making it easy to plan weekly meals. Although it requires a subscription, many users find the cost justified by the time saved.
2. Budget Bytes
While Budget Bytes is not exclusively a meal prep app, it offers a wealth of low-cost, easy-to-prepare recipes that are perfect for batch cooking. The platform's emphasis on affordability makes it a valuable resource for families looking to save on grocery bills while maintaining a balanced diet.
3. Strongr Fastr
Strongr Fastr combines meal planning with fitness goals, making it ideal for parents who want to maintain a healthy lifestyle. The app provides simple, high-protein recipes, helping you meet your nutritional goals. It's particularly useful for those who appreciate simplicity and crave a little extra protein in their diet.
Practical Tips for Effective Meal Prep
- Start Small: Begin with one or two meals a week to avoid feeling overwhelmed.
- Choose Versatile Ingredients: Opt for staples like chicken, beans, and rice that can be used in multiple recipes.
- Batch Cook: Prepare large quantities and freeze portions to save time on busy days.
- Organize Your Pantry: Keep a well-stocked pantry to simplify meal prep and reduce grocery shopping trips.
- Utilize Leftovers: Plan meals that allow you to creatively use leftovers, minimizing waste and saving money.
Where to Shop for Meal Prep Ingredients
Finding the best place to buy your meal prep ingredients can significantly affect your budget and convenience. Here are some options:
- Local Grocery Stores: Keep an eye on weekly sales and discounts. Many stores offer loyalty programs that can save you money over time.
- Warehouse Clubs: Buying in bulk from places like Costco or Sam’s Club can be cost-effective for staples.
- Farmers Markets: Fresh, seasonal produce can often be found at reasonable prices, supporting local farmers.
- Online Grocery Services: Services like Instacart or Amazon Fresh offer the convenience of home delivery, saving you time and effort.
FAQs
What should I look for in a meal prep app?
Look for apps that offer recipe versatility, ease of use, and features like grocery list integration and nutritional information. Consider whether the app aligns with your dietary goals and budget.
Are paid meal prep apps worth it?
Paid apps often offer advanced features like customized meal plans and more extensive recipe libraries. If these features align with your needs, the cost can be worthwhile.
Can I meal prep with a limited budget?
Absolutely! Focus on affordable staples, buy in bulk, and make use of sales and discounts. Meal prepping can actually help you save money by reducing food waste.
How long can meal-prepped food be stored?
Most prepared meals can be stored in the refrigerator for 3-5 days. For longer storage, consider freezing meals, which can keep them fresh for several months.
How can I involve my kids in meal prep?
Involve kids by letting them choose recipes or help with simple tasks like washing vegetables or measuring ingredients. This can make meal prep a fun family activity!
